K. Kusabiraki et al., LATTICE-CONSTANTS OF GAMMA-PHASE AND GAMMA''-PHASE AND GAMMA'' GAMMA-LATTICE MISMATCHES IN A NI-15-CR-8-FE-6-NB ALLOY/, ISIJ international, 36(3), 1996, pp. 310-316
The lattice parameters of gamma and gamma '' phases and the gamma ''/g
amma lattice mismatches in a nickel-base superalloy, a modified NCF 3
type alloy, are investigated by X-ray diffraction. The measurement on
the gamma '' phase is carried out using gamma '' precipitates extracte
d from the alloy. The relationship between the morphology of the gamma
'' phase and the lattice parameters of the gamma and gamma '' phases
and gamma ''/gamma lattice mismatches is discussed in detail. With inc
reasing aging time, the lattice parameter of the gamma phase decreases
and those of the gamma '' phase increase. The former after a certain
aging time reaches at a constant value at each aging temperature. The
changes in the lattice parameters in various aging conditions suggest
a change in the composition of the gamma and gamma '' phases. The gamm
a ''/gamma lattice mismatch in the direction normal to the habit plane
of the gamma '' plate, i.e. parallel to the c axis is nearly twice gr
eater than that in the plane. The dependence of the morphology of the
gamma '' phase on the lattice parameters, the gamma ''/gamma lattice m
ismatches and the axis ratio c(0)/a(0) for the gamma '' phase is not c
lear. The gamma '' phase precipitated at 1073 K in a square plate-like
morphology is incoherent with the matrix in the direction of the c ax
is, while that precipitated at up to 1033 K in a near disc-shaped morp
hology is coherent.
